Riverview Health announced that effective immediately no visitors will be allowed except for one dedicated support person in maternity, situations involving end-of-life care and pediatric patients. Those individuals in outpatient procedural areas will be allowed one visitor at a time to accompany them. Allowed visitors must not have any flu-like symptoms and must be immediate family, parent, spouse or significant other.
In addition, beginning Tuesday, March 17, Riverview Health will limit surgical cases on a case-by-case basis.
Riverview Health is comprised of a full-service, 156-bed hospital in Noblesville, a 16-bed hospital in Westfield, as well as freestanding combined ER and urgent care facilities. Also included are more than 25 primary, immediate and specialty-care facilities in Hamilton County. Riverview Health provides comprehensive inpatient and outpatient services in more than 35 healthcare specialties and has been frequently recognized for its clinical and service excellence. National achievements include Healthgrades America's 100 Best Hospitals for Orthopedic Surgery award (2019) and Outstanding Patient Experience award (2017-2018). Leapfrog Group awarded Riverview Health an A grade—the highest grade possible—for patient safety in 2017. As one of the largest employers in Hamilton County, Riverview Health recently received the Five-Star AchieveWELL Award through the Wellness Council of Indiana and was honored at the 2017 Indiana Health and Wellness Summit.
